Before lodgement
Check application details, plans, specifications, engineering, H1, drainage and supporting forms for missing information and revision conflicts.
During processing
Turn an RFI into plain-English actions, owners and a point-by-point response register linked to the affected documents.
During the build
Collect inspections, photographs, Records of Work, producer statements, test results, variations and as-builts before work is covered.
At CCC
Review the issued consent conditions and assemble an indexed close-out record for the project team to submit to the BCA.
